A new lead was answered and then went quiet. When does WACO follow up automatically, how many times, and when does it stop?

A NEW customer you already replied to who then goes quiet for 24 hours receives one follow-up from your number. Once per customer, and it stops by itself the moment they reply. Switch in the Operator AI menu. 4 min read

Who counts as a "quiet lead"

All of the following must be true at the same time:

  1. A new customer: the number contacted you for the first time and was not in your Contacts when that first chat arrived. Known customers are never followed up automatically.
  2. Your team already replied — from the team inbox, the API, or the WhatsApp app on the phone for a coexistence number. Replies by the AI Operator count too.
  3. It is the customer's turn and they are silent: the last message in the conversation is from your team, and 24 hours have passed since that reply with nothing from the customer.
  4. The conversation is still fresh: their first chat arrived at most 7 days ago.
  5. Never followed up before: that number has not received a WACO follow-up yet.

Turning it on

  1. Open Operator AI → the Follow-up for quiet leads card.
  2. Tick Send an automatic follow-up to quiet leads, then Save.
  3. The first time it is switched on, WACO submits the follow-up template to WhatsApp on behalf of your number. Sending starts once the template is approved, usually within minutes. Its status is visible in the Templates menu.
This feature is off by default and only you can switch it on. The message text is fixed and cannot be edited, so the UTILITY template is not rejected by Meta.
